The public is invited to The Willows for Westborough’s 18th Annual Celebration of Senior Health and Fitness Day, which will enlighten participants on how to take control of their health to enjoy active and full lives.
PEP (Personalized Exercise Program) Fitness Director, Karen McKenzie along with Executive Director, Ben Colonero will lead the free celebration in The Willows’ Community Room beginning with registration and a complimentary continental breakfast at 9 a.m.
At 10 a.m., key note speaker Sandra Boris-Berkowitz of Laughing Matters will talk to the audience about the power of humor to relieve stress and promote healing. Learn how incorporating laughter into your life for a daily dose of happy healing can benefit you tremendously. Boris-Berkowitz, M.Ed., LRC, is a Laughter Yoga Leader certified by the Dr. Kataria School of Laughter Yoga. She is also a teacher and a licensed rehabilitation counselor.

The program will also include a discussion with guest Ann Pautazis on how proper nutrition fuels the body and mind. Pautazis is a Nutritionist Registered Dietitian doctor in Worcester, MA.
A break will follow the program with refreshments and a range of activities including blood pressure testing, mini massages, balance evaluations and strength testing. McKenzie and Colonero invite visitors to stick around afterwards for a tour of their independent living community and the PEP Center, as well as raffle giveaways.
